Why High-Limit Credit Cards Matter

Before choosing a card, it’s important to understand how a higher credit limit benefits you:

1. Increases Your Credit Score

A higher limit reduces your credit utilization ratio — one of the biggest factors in credit scoring.

2. Gives You More Spending Freedom

You can make big purchases easily without maxing out your card.

3. Lower Chance of Over-Limit Fees

More space = more safety.

4. Better Approval Odds for Premium Cards Later

Banks trust high-limit cardholders more.

5. Improves Emergency Financial Safety

A high limit can be your backup fund when needed.

🔍 How to Get a Higher Credit Limit (Fast & Legally)

These methods work for beginners, students, and new credit applicants.


1. Keep Utilization Below 30%

If your limit is $1,000, spend only $200–$300.

Lower utilization = higher credit score = higher limits.


2. Always Pay on Time

One late payment can stop your credit line increases for a year.


3. Ask for a Credit Limit Increase Every 6 Months

Most banks allow limit increase requests online.


4. Increase Your Income in Your Profile

Banks give higher limits to users with higher reported income.


5. Avoid Multiple Credit Applications

Too many hard inquiries signal risk.


6. Maintain a Long-Term Relationship With Your Bank

The longer your account age, the better your growth potential.
